10 Must-Visit Attractions in Absecon, NJ

Posted on 02 May, 2023 at 08:23 am - by

1. Absecon Lighthouse

The Absecon Lighthouse is an iconic landmark in Absecon, and it's a must-visit attraction for anyone traveling to the area. This historic lighthouse was first built in 1857 and has since been restored to its former glory. Visitors can climb to the top of the lighthouse for panoramic views of the city and the surrounding area.

 

2. Edwin B. Forsythe National Wildlife Refuge

If you love nature, the Edwin B. Forsythe National Wildlife Refuge is a must-visit attraction. This expansive wildlife refuge covers over 47,000 acres and is home to a wide range of wildlife, including migratory birds, fish, and other animals. Visitors can explore the refuge on foot or by car and enjoy the beautiful scenery.
